A woman has gone viral after trying out a hack for clearing sinuses – which involves putting a clove of garlic into each nostril.

Rozaline Katherine, 29, decided to try out the tip after seeing it on TikTok and her clip has racked up millions of views.

In a video of her putting the method to the test, Rozaline can be seen inserting the garlic cloves into her nostrils.

She waits 10-15 minutes and then removes them.

The content creator is stunned as she films snot pouring from her nose and declares that, in her opinion, the method works.

“I didn’t think it was actually going to work which is why I filmed it more as a joke,” Rozaline, from Arizona, US, told Jam Press.

“I just peeled two fresh cloves of garlic and put one in each nostril. I set a timer for 10 minutes and just watched TV while I waited.

“It didn’t burn or hurt and I just kept touching it to keep it in place and waited.

“After 10-15 minutes I could tell my nose was starting to run so I took the garlic out.

“I was expecting it to be a little runny but then tons of boogers just started coming out and I was totally shocked.

“I didn’t smell any garlic afterwards either – I think my sinuses were flushed out.

“I was totally surprised by the results.”

The TikTok has been viewed more than 4.3 million times and racked up over 500,000 likes – but viewers are divided over the hack.

One person said: “Brb gotta try it bc I haven’t been breathing well for two weeks now.” [sic]

“I will be trying this,” another eager viewer said.

Someone else commented: “Keeping this video in my back pocket for later colds.”

“Yesss thank you I’m so doing this,” one person agreed. [sic]

Other people called the trick “amazing” and “oddly satisfying”.

Other viewers were less impressed by the hack and Rozaline sharing the results on camera.

One person said: “This is where TikTok reaches its limit.”

“Was not expecting to see the last part,” another viewer said.

Someone else commented: “You’ll be able to smell garlic for a whole year after that.”

“No thanks before I know I accidentally inhale through my nose and the garlic disappears,” one worried viewer added. [sic]

Another person said: “Did you really have to show the snot sis??? I’m eating ramen and I wanna throw up.” [sic]
